This week’s guest is Dr Meike Bartels, Professor in genetics and wellbeing, and president of IPPA - the International Positive Psychology Association. Meike talks a bit about her background in the study of genetics as it relates to wellbeing, and clears up some of the misinterpretations of the relationship between the two. She talks about what it was like coming from the field of genetics which demanded a high level of scientific rigor and accountability, to positive psychology conferences which focused a lot on subjective experiences. Rather than let this dissuade her, she remained in the positive psychology world to attempt to improve it, and eventually went on to become the president of its largest association. Meike stresses the importance of collaboration within this type of research, how that can combat the issue of underpowered studies, and allow researchers to combine their expertise. Meike also gives us a little insight into some of the opportunities she has had as president of IPPA, including a project involving Vatican City.
